Understanding Auto Glass Damage


Auto glass damage can result from various factors, ranging from small rocks kicked up by other vehicles on the road to extreme weather conditions like hailstorms. The most common types of damage include cracks, chips, and scratches on the windshield or windows of a vehicle. It is essential to address these issues promptly to prevent them from worsening and requiring a full windshield replacement.

In Jacksonville, NC, drivers often encounter windshield damage due to the highway debris and gravel roads prevalent in the area. A small chip or crack may seem insignificant at first glance, but it can compromise the structural integrity of your auto glass over time.
